1922 Muskogee Mets Roster

Southwestern League (SL) - Class: C
Team Record: 84-53
Finished 1st in the SL
Manager: Roy Corgan (84-53)
Location: Muskogee, Oklahoma
Ballpark: W.A. Owen Field, League Park

1922 Muskogee Mets Statistics

Playoffs - Sapulpa Yanks 4 games, Muskogee Mets 2

The Muskogee Mets of the Southwestern League ended the 1922 season with a record of 84 wins and 53 losses, finishing first in the SL.

Roy Corgan served as manager.
